# How to Drop Bad Lines with read_csv in Pandas
- URL: https://datascientyst.com/drop-bad-lines-with-read_csv-pandas/
- Published: 2021-11-03T12:37:23.000Z
- Updated: 2026-07-22T22:19:53.000Z
- Author: John D K
- Tags: read_csv()

Here are two approaches to **drop bad lines with `read_csv` in Pandas**, when `on_bad_lines` is the only option, since:

- `error_bad_lines`
- `warn_bad_lines`

were removed in pandas 2.0.

**(1) Parameter `on_bad_lines='skip'` — Pandas >= 1.3 (current, recommended)**

```python
df = pd.read_csv(csv_file, delimiter=';', on_bad_lines='skip')

```

**(2) `error_bad_lines=False` — Pandas < 1.3 (removed, do not use)**

```python
# ❌ No longer works — raises TypeError on any pandas 2.x install
df = pd.read_csv(csv_file, delimiter=';', error_bad_lines=False)

```

`error_bad_lines` and `warn_bad_lines` were deprecated back in pandas 1.3 and fully **removed in pandas 2.0.0**. If you still have this in an older script, calling it on a modern pandas version will raise `TypeError: read_csv() got an unexpected keyword argument 'error_bad_lines'`. There's no fallback or compatibility shim — you need to switch to `on_bad_lines`.

Suppose we have two files:

- Single separator `;`  
```  
Date;Company A;Company A;Company B;Company B  
2021-09-06;1;7.9;2;6  
2021-09-07;1;8.5;2;7  
2021-09-08;2;8;1;8.1  
2021-09-09;2;8;1;"8.3;5.5"  
```
- Double separator `;;`  
```  
Date;;Company A;;Company A;;Company B;;Company B  
2021-09-06;;1;;7.9;;2;;6  
2021-09-07;;1;;8.5;;2;;7  
2021-09-08;;2;;8;;1;;8.1  
2021-09-09;;2;;8;;1;;"8.3;;5.5"  
```

## The `on_bad_lines` parameter

```
on_bad_lines{'error', 'warn', 'skip'} or callable, default 'error'

```

Specifies what to do upon encountering a bad line (a line with too many fields). Allowed values are:

- `error` — raise an exception when a bad line is encountered (this is still the default).
- `warn` — raise a warning when a bad line is encountered and skip that line.
- `skip` — skip bad lines without raising or warning when they are encountered.
- **callable** — since pandas 1.4, you can also pass a function. It receives the bad line as a list of strings and can return a corrected list of fields (to fix the row instead of dropping it), or `None` to drop it. This only works with the `engine='python'` parser.

Example of the callable form, useful when you want to repair rather than discard a malformed row:

```python
def fix_row(bad_line):
    # keep only the first 5 fields, drop the rest
    return bad_line[:5]

df = pd.read_csv(csv_file, delimiter=';', engine='python', on_bad_lines=fix_row)

```

Note that depending on the separator:

- single
- multiple
- regex

the `read_csv` behavior can be different. You can check this article for more information: [How to Use Multiple Char Separator in read\_csv in Pandas](https://datascientyst.com/use-multiple-char-separator-read%5Fcsv-pandas/)

The reason for this is described in the pandas documentation:

> Note that regex delimiters are prone to ignoring quoted data. Regex example: `'\r\t'`.

Any separator longer than one character (like our `;;` example) is treated as a regex by the parser, which is why quoted fields containing the delimiter get mis-split — this behavior is unchanged in current pandas.

For example, for a single separator `";"` this code will work fine:

| Date       | Company A | Company A.1 | Company B | Company B.1 |
| ---------- | --------- | ----------- | --------- | ----------- |
| 2021-09-06 | 1         | 7.9         | 2         | 6           |
| 2021-09-07 | 1         | 8.5         | 2         | 7           |
| 2021-09-08 | 2         | 8.0         | 1         | 8.1         |
| 2021-09-09 | 2         | 8.0         | 1         | 8.3;5.5     |

While if you have a file with two separators you will get an error or warning (depending on `on_bad_lines`) for the quoted line:

```python
csv_file = '../data/csv/multine_bad_line_multi_sep.csv'
df = pd.read_csv(csv_file, delimiter=';;', engine='python', on_bad_lines='warn')

```

> Skipping line 5: Expected 5 fields in line 5, saw 6\. Error could possibly be due to quotes being ignored when a multi-char delimiter is used.

In this case only 3 rows will be read from the CSV file:

| Date       | Company A | Company A.1 | Company B | Company B.1 |
| ---------- | --------- | ----------- | --------- | ----------- |
| 2021-09-06 | 1         | 7.9         | 2         | 6.0         |
| 2021-09-07 | 1         | 8.5         | 2         | 7.0         |
| 2021-09-08 | 2         | 8.0         | 1         | 8.1         |

## A quick note on the C vs Python engine

With a single-character delimiter, pandas defaults to the fast C engine, which supports `on_bad_lines='error'|'warn'|'skip'` natively. With a multi-character or regex delimiter, pandas automatically falls back to `engine='python'`, which is slower but is also the only engine that supports a **callable** passed to `on_bad_lines`. If you need to fix (not just skip) bad lines and you're on a single-character delimiter, you must explicitly pass `engine='python'` yourself, as shown above.
